D:\python3.9\python.exe C:/Users/Administrator/Desktop/pycharm代码/练习2.py
Traceback (most recent call last):
File "C:\Users\Administrator\Desktop\pycharm代码\练习2.py", line 5, in
page_text=requests.get(url=url,headers=headers).content
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\api.py", line 75, in get
return request('get', url, params=params, **kwargs)
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\api.py", line 61, in request
return session.request(method=method, url=url, **kwargs)
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\sessions.py", line 542, in request
resp = self.send(prep, **send_kwargs)
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\sessions.py", line 677, in send
history = [resp for resp in gen]
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\sessions.py", line 677, in
history = [resp for resp in gen]
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\sessions.py", line 150, in resolve_redirects
url = self.get_redirect_target(resp)
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\sessions.py", line 107, in get_redirect_target
location = resp.headers['location']
File "C:\Users\Administrator\AppData\Roaming\Python\Python39\site-packages\requests\structures.py", line 54, in getitem
return self._store[key.lower()][1]
KeyError: 'location'

请问报这种错误怎么解决
- 写回答
- 好问题 0 提建议
- 关注问题
- 邀请回答
-
2条回答 默认 最新
- keenanli 2022-04-20 13:48关注
self._store你可以打印出来看看。
store没有location这个key本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报 编辑记录